The Breakdown 71

  • Iran is in a state of deep mourning following the assassination of former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, who was killed in a U.S.-Israeli airstrike at the beginning of the Iran war, marking a critical moment in the nation's history.
  • The week-long funeral ceremonies, beginning on July 4, are drawing millions of mourners across the country, transforming streets into seas of black-clad citizens chanting slogans like “Death to America!” and “Revenge, revenge!” that echo the prevailing sentiments against U.S. and Israeli forces.
  • As the public pays its respects, the absence of Khamenei's son and successor, Mojtaba Khamenei, raises eyebrows and fuels speculation about internal power struggles within Iran’s leadership amid his father’s shadow.
  • The attendance of foreign officials from various nations and groups at the funeral underscores the geopolitical significance of Khamenei's death, highlighting how this event resonates well beyond Iran's borders and impacts international relations in a volatile region.
  • Concerns about security loom large as authorities ensure the safety of high-profile mourners during the ceremonies, demonstrating the fragile balance between mourning and the potential for further conflict.
  • The events surrounding Khamenei's funeral serve as both a tribute to his legacy and a critical juncture for Iran's future, as the nation navigates the complexities of leadership transitions and the pursuit of unity amid external challenges.

What are the historical ties between Iran and Hezbollah?

Iran and Hezbollah share a longstanding alliance rooted in ideological and military cooperation. Since the 1980s, Iran has provided Hezbollah with financial, military, and logistical support, viewing the group as a key ally in its resistance against Israel. This relationship has been instrumental in shaping regional dynamics, particularly in Lebanon and during conflicts involving Israel.
